Read onlyWE MAKE CANDKES WAX MELTS AND DIFFUSERS AND AS WE MAKE THEM IM NOT SURE HOW TO LIST CAN ANYONE HELP? DO I SET THEM AS GENERIC OR HOW DO I HAVE OUR COMANYS NAME PUT A THE BRAND WITHOUT A LOAD OF HEADACHE
if you are making them yourself, and are serious about it - look up Amazon Brand Registry.
Thats the safest route for you. Alternatively,you can list as Generic - but if you have a brand - it makes sense to use it.
Try registering for Amazon Handmade and then Brand Registry.
I was professional seller before Handmade came into being, swapped over and the professional fee was waived for a year - it's still waived, years later! I then applied for trademark and became Brand Registered whilst the trademark was pending (just provided the confirmation number of awaiting trademark approval). It was really easy.
